Cape Town – An ANC MP has called for racists to be "blacklisted".

Jabulani Mahlangu made the call during a debate on racism in the National Assembly, which was requested by FF Plus MP Pieter Mulder.

Mahlangu reiterated the call for the criminalising of racism.

"We call for the establishment of a national register of racist offenders as part of tightening the legislation. We need to ensure that racists are blacklisted," he said.

He said the list of racists should be made available to embassies, so they might reject applications for visas and work permits.

Mulder said racism must be condemned by all.

He questioned the root of the university protests.

He said the current protests were mostly artificial.

Mulder said small numbers of activists were fuelling the violence in the universities.

DA MP Professor Belinda Bozzoli said it was not unexpected that racial hatred had emerged.

"The unstoppable force of increasing numbers of poor students has met the immovable object of the costs of running proper universities," she said.

EFF MP Thembinkosi Rawula said the violence of racism frowned on black dreams.

He said black people were not considered human by racists.

This, he said, was why it was normal for black people to earn up to six times less than their white counterparts.

UDM MP Nqabayomzi Kwankwa said Afrikaans should not be forced on students.
